MSOC: Pride Pick Up 1-0 Win At Drexel

10/20/2011 2:22:00 AM

Philadelphia, PA - Chris Griebsch's unassisted goal at 60:51 was all the Pride would need as Roberto Pellegrini posted seven saves for his third shutout of the season in Hofstra's 1-0 Colonial Athletic Association win over Drexel at rainy Vidas Field.

Hofstra improves to 6-7, 3-4 in the CAA. Drexel drops to 3-9-2, 2-4-1 in league play. The win snapped a three-match losing streak for the Pride.

Griebsch capitalized on a misplayed goal kick by the Dragons and rocketed a shot past Drexel keeper Pentti Pussinen for his third goal of the season.

Drexel controlled the play in the first half, holding a 9-4 shot advantage, but Pellegrini had four saves in the first and added three more in the second half as he stonewalled any attempt at a Drexel comeback. The Dragons finished the night with a 14-8 shot advantage.

Pussinen finished with three saves.

Hofstra returns to action Saturday night at No. 11 Old Dominion.
